Philippe Quint, renowned violinist, presents a captivating album featuring the works of Glazunov and Khachaturian. Released on September 9, 2016, under the Avanticlassic label, this album showcases Quint's extraordinary talent and musical prowess. The album is a collection of seven tracks, including the Overture from Colas Breugnon, Op. 24, and both Glazunov's and Khachaturian's Violin Concertos in their entirety. Each piece is performed with precision and passion, highlighting the rich, expressive tones of the 1708 "Ruby" Antonio Stradivari violin, which is on loan to Quint through The Stradivari Society®.
Quint is accompanied by the Bochumer Symphoniker, conducted by Steven Sloane, creating a harmonious blend of orchestral and solo violin performances.
